The Shattered Calm of River Road

The tranquil stretch of River Road near the L’Auberge Casino became the site of a nightmare on Monday night when the vehicle Zacariah was in failed to negotiate a curve and struck a utility pole. The sheer violence of the impact, which claimed three lives in total, has left the local neighborhood reeling. This wasn’t just an accident; it was a catastrophic event that turned a routine drive into a scene of mourning. Investigators believe speed may have played a factor, a chilling reminder of how quickly life can change in the blink of an eye.
